One morning after disappearing, Jim was discovered with no boots, hat or coat in the filter beds below the aquarium tanks in the basement of Blackpool Tower and had drowned in 3 4 of water. Jim had many unusual beliefs including his daily practise of taking a sip from a cupful of water from his tanks to benefit from its "medicinal properties". [9][13] On 22 December 1894, Norwegian ship Abana was sailing from Liverpool to Savannah, Georgia, but was caught up in a storm, and mistook the recently built Blackpool Tower for a lighthouse.
